Perhaps you just need to sort your list of keywords. The IDL docs say:


The IDL_KW_PAR struct provides the basic specification for keyword
processing.

The IDL_KWProcessByOffset() function is passed a null-terminated array of
these

structures. IDL_KW_PAR structures specify which keywords a routine accepts,
the

attributes required of them, and the kinds of processing that should be done
to them.

IDL_KW_PAR structures must be defined in lexical order according to the
value of

the keyword field.



Karl

Haje,

"Haje Korth" <haje.korth@jhuapl.edu> wrote in message news:<cf7tm7$k8a$1@aplcore.jhuapl.edu>...

> JG,

>

> I use the lines below to do keyword checking and it works great. I recommend

> Ronn Kling's book, it will get you up to speed quickly.

>

> Haje


Thanks. I'll have to look up Kling's book. I use nearly the same
syntax as you indicated in your email, except that I have 7 keywords
instead of 1. The code compiles without error messages and functions
correctly with no keywords. With keywords, the code accepts only 2 of
the 7 defined and reports that the other 5 keywords are "not allowed"
in the call to the function.

If none of them worked, I'd at least look for a syntactical error.
But since 2 of the 7 are recognized and all are declared exactly the
same way, I'm at a loss.

Here are my declaration statements (keywords medium and hi function
correctly while the others cause "keyword not allowed" errors to be
issued by IDL. See my previous posting.):

typedef struct {
IDL_KW_RESULT_FIRST_FIELD;
IDL_LONG x;
IDL_LONG y;
IDL_LONG z;
IDL_LONG medium;
IDL_LONG hi;
IDL_LONG overwrite;
IDL_LONG cleanup;
} KW_RESULT;
static IDL_KW_PAR kw_pars[] = {
IDL_KW_FAST_SCAN,
{"X", IDL_TYP_LONG, 1, IDL_KW_ZERO|IDL_KW_VALUE|15, 0,
IDL_KW_OFFSETOF(x)},
{"Y", IDL_TYP_LONG, 1, IDL_KW_ZERO|IDL_KW_VALUE|15, 0,
IDL_KW_OFFSETOF(y)},
{"Z", IDL_TYP_LONG, 1, IDL_KW_ZERO|IDL_KW_VALUE|15, 0,
IDL_KW_OFFSETOF(z)},
{"HI", IDL_TYP_LONG, 1, IDL_KW_ZERO|IDL_KW_VALUE|15, 0,
IDL_KW_OFFSETOF(hi)},
{"OVERWRITE", IDL_TYP_LONG, 1, IDL_KW_ZERO|IDL_KW_VALUE|15, 0,
IDL_KW_OFFSETOF(overwrite) },
{"MEDIUM", IDL_TYP_LONG, 1, IDL_KW_ZERO|IDL_KW_VALUE|15, 0,
IDL_KW_OFFSETOF(medium) },
{"CLEANUP", IDL_TYP_LONG, 1, IDL_KW_ZERO|IDL_KW_VALUE|15, 0,
IDL_KW_OFFSETOF(cleanup) },
{NULL}
};
KW_RESULT kw;

(void) IDL_KWProcessByOffset(argc, argv, argk, kw_pars,
(IDL_VPTR *) 0, 1, &kw);

Maybe I shouldn't use IDL_KW_VALUE? I adopted the same syntax here as
in the example given in the 5.6 manual as well as Henry Chapman's
similar DLM.

The DLM is included in my previous post.

Still stumped,
JGG.

JG,

I use the lines below to do keyword checking and it works great. I recommend
Ronn Kling's book, it will get you up to speed quickly.

Haje



typedef struct {

IDL_KW_RESULT_FIRST_FIELD;

int degree;

} KW_RESULT;


static IDL_KW_PAR kw_pars[] = { IDL_KW_FAST_SCAN,

{"DEGREE",IDL_TYP_LONG,1,IDL_KW_ZERO,0,IDL_KW_OFFSETOF(degree)},

{NULL}

};


KW_RESULT kw;

IDL_KWProcessByOffset(argc,argv,argk,kw_pars,0,1,&kw);
